Grid Lines for SU! Clear Blocks

Yippee!  My SU! order arrived tonight...included was the new grid line templates to add to the clear blocks.


My initial thought was how heck do I get these on the block STRAIGHT?!  Oh boy. 

Then it hit me...SU! grid line paper!  Line the block up in the corner...



Peel off the...whatcha call it...well...cling vinyl.  Line up one line on the vinyl with a line you can see through the block.  You gotta stand up...and hover over the block.  Then just lay the vinyl over the block...it smoothes right out.  Use the same technique you use to stamp clear stamps using clear blocks.  The cling vinyl grid line template doesn't have to be perfectly in the center of the block; but it should be straight in relation to the edge of the block.  I had some overlap in the larger clear block, but the cling vinyl clings really well and it smoothes right over.  I cleaned the side of the block I was adding the vinyl to and I will use the other side for stamps. 

I only did two blocks - I use these two most at the moment.  The others, I will add if I must have a need for grid lines on a different sized block.  Not a big deal because I thought it was really simple & quick to add the grid line templates.  They remove cleanly and go right back on the sheet (for storage).  They come in a zip top bag with a piece of sturdy cardboard.  I'm impressed.  I like them because I can remove them if I don't need them; put them back on quickly if I do.
